poems
from the dome
These poems featured in a
special meridian-line display at the Millennium Dome exhibition, Greenwich, UK.
La Marque
by Shaïda Zarumey, 1941, Mali
Sur quatre pétales de la fleur brune et rouge
Que tu tenais lovée dans ta main Sultan
Tu as gravé en les ciselant
De la pointe de ton crayon
Les quinze lettres de ton nom
Sur les quatre pétales de la fleur brune et rouge
Que tu tenais ovée dans ta main
Tu as gravé à vif ton nom pur l'éternité.
The Mark
On the four petals of that brown and red flower
You hold coiled in your palm Sultan
You have inscribed with a pencil's point
The fifteen letters of your name
On the petals of that brown and red flower
You hold egg-like in your palm
You have sketched your name for ever more.
translated
by Robert Fraser
